How much does it cost to rent a home in King County?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| King County 2 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,881 | $1,400 | $7,500 |
| King County 3 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$3,545 | $1,150 | $9,500 |
| King County 4 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$4,285 | $800 | $10,000+ |
| King County 5 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$4,693 | $2,850 | $9,995 |
| King County 6 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$5,913 | $4,800 | $8,000 |
| King County 7 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$5,850 | $5,700 | $6,000 |

What type of rentals are currently available in King County?
There are currently 9128 Apartments for Rent in King County, WA with pricing that ranges from $546 to $31,995. There are also 1248 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in King County ranging from $525 to $10,000.
What is the current price range for Rental Homes in King County?
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in King County ranges from $525 to $10,000 with an average monthly rent of $4,642.
How much are larger Three and Four Bedroom Rentals in King County?
For those who are looking for larger living arrangements, Three Bedroom Apartments in King County range from $1,099 to $31,995, while Three Bedroom Homes, Condos, and Townhomes for rent range from $1,150 to $9,500. Four Bedroom Single-Family rentals are also available starting from $800 and Four Bedroom Apartments start at $1,099.
